Cygwin Bash Buffer Overflow Author: Rodrigo Gutierrez <rodrigo () intellicomp cl> Affected: Versions of bash distributed by the cygwin project vendor url: http://www.cygwin.com Type: Local
Background. Cygwin is a Linux-like environment for Windows. GNU BASH is the GNU project's UNIX shell. It replaces the standard UNIX Bourne and Korn shells.

PoC
you@cygwin:~ /usr/bin/bash `perl -e "print 'a'x8388600"`
Which version of bash for Cygwin? I tried your PoC on the latest version of Cygwin and everything was fine.
